9 The Oaks

    9, THE OAKS, HAYES, UB4 8QD

    This terraced freehold property on The Oaks last sold in January 1996 for £68,500. Based on price growth in the UB4 district since then, its estimated current value is £504,887 — placing it in the 79th percentile nationally and the 61st percentile within UB4. The property covers 85 m² (915 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£5,940 per m². The EPC rating is E, with a potential rating of C.

    District Context — UB4

    UB4 covers parts of west London, including areas around Hayes and Uxbridge on the outskirts of the capital. It is a mixed suburban district with good transport links and a diverse housing stock, appealing to families and commuters.
